Objectives

Purpose for the cruise was to quantitatively clarify the physical, chemical and biological processes which occur in the Sea of Okhotsk. This expedition is collaboration between Far Eastern Regional Hydrometeorological Research Institute (FERHRI), Russia, and the Institute of Low Temperature Sciences, Hokkaido University, Japan.  Especially this expedition focused on to sedimentary iron transport processes from northwestern continental shelf of the Sea of Okhotsk to western subarctic Pacific.
